Ticket: Drift in driver-assignment heuristic config (Routewren dispatch). Prod and staging disagree on radius weighting and idle-driver penalty, so assignments differ per environment and QA keeps filing false bugs. Someone edited prod directly last quarter; the change never landed in the repo. Task: diff against the baseline, pick the correct values with the dispatch lead, commit, and redeploy staging first. Don't touch surge multipliers — separate owner. Current prod values as pulled this morning follow.

service settings:
[silwyn]
host = silwyn.crelvogrid.internal
user = silwyn_svc
database = silwyn_prod

Ticket: Relayline client fails to reconnect after idle websocket drop

When the Harborquill gateway closes an idle socket, the client schedules a reconnect but never fires it because the backoff timer is cleared during teardown. Reproduce by idling a session for ten minutes on staging. Attach console logs and note the trace token below.

trace token, kahog-tajeg: htk6_97d963

Prepared for the incoming director ahead of the leadership review. The proposed franchise agreement with Ostler Hospitality covers twelve sites across the Narbeth region over three years. Key terms: fixed royalty of 6%, shared fit-out costs, and a two-year exclusivity window. Legal review is complete; operational readiness was assessed by Callum Dray's team and rated acceptable with minor conditions. Outstanding items concern supply logistics and training capacity. The strategic context is set out directly below.

internal memo for taguf-kafop: Novmirax Group plans to lower the Oliius list price by 42.0 percent in March. The board signed off on a budget of $367.8 million for Project Belael. The renewal with Drumirax Logistics closes at $302.4 million a year, 54.0 percent below the last contract. Project Kelys slips by a full year because of the staffing delay.